Output 503c563156d112c60219ff2464e7dd5c9c039c630135c6cd1a685cefa1fd3f2a:1

value
1479543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d79b59d6b73dfcce348662baee83ee3d39d674a OP_EQUAL
address
35qU8hJvbcECUnYLKjVWCqVTmbRuZ2wqbT
transaction
503c563156d112c60219ff2464e7dd5c9c039c630135c6cd1a685cefa1fd3f2a
spent
true